About Vincent L. Butty

Vincent L. Butty is a scholar working on Aging, Immunology and Allergy and Molecular Biology, having authored 41 papers that have together received 2.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include RNA Research and Splicing (6 papers),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(5 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Aging (84 citations), Cancer Research (714 citations) and Neurology (216 citations). Vincent L. Butty has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Australia and India. Frequent co-authors include Laurie A. Boyer, Stuart S. Levine, Richard Lee, Ryan Abo, Christopher B. Burge, Paul Fields, Lauren E. Surface, Robert K. Bradley, Simon Haas and Huiming Ding. Their work appears in journals such as Cell,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of the American Chemical Society.
